Is Vomiting During Colonoscopy Prep Normal and How to Manage It?

Learn why vomiting can occur during colonoscopy prep and how to handle it effectively for a smoother procedure.

126 views

Yes, it is not uncommon to experience vomiting during colonoscopy prep, due to the large volume and unpleasant taste of the preparation solution. However, if vomiting persists, it’s important to contact your healthcare provider. They may recommend alternative prep solutions or adjust your dosage to help you tolerate the prep better. Staying hydrated and following the prep instructions carefully can also minimize discomfort during this process.
